• 
    <ul id="o6k0g"></ul>
    <ul id="o6k0g"></ul>

    業務關鍵數據的實時備份方法技術

    技術編號:10040254 閱讀:155 留言:0更新日期:2014-05-14 10:51
    本發明專利技術公開了一種業務關鍵數據的實時備份方法,其實施步驟如下:1)建立業務關鍵數據文件列表;2)實時檢測文件系統的每一個文件寫入操作;3)將文件寫入操作的目標文件與業務關鍵數據文件列表進行比較,如果匹配則首先執行文件寫入操作,然后在文件寫入操作完畢后為文件寫入操作的目標文件建立備份文件。本發明專利技術能夠為業務關鍵數據根據文件寫入操作建立實時副本,具有可靠性高、資源消耗低、實用性好、操作簡單方便的優點。

    【技術實現步驟摘要】

    本專利技術涉及數據存儲領域,具體涉及一種業務關鍵數據的實時備份方法
    技術介紹
    現有技術數據存儲領域針對文件的備份都是通過定時備份的,缺少實時備份的方法。而對于高可靠性要求的業務關鍵數據,可能需要涉及修改的每一個業務關鍵數據副本,現有技術的備份方案無法實現針對業務關鍵數據的備份。
    技術實現思路
    本專利技術要解決的技術問題是提供一種能夠為業務關鍵數據根據文件寫入操作建立實時副本,可靠性高、資源消耗低、實用性好、操作簡單方便的業務關鍵數據的實時備份方法。為解決上述技術問題,本專利技術采用的技術方案為:一種業務關鍵數據的實時備份方法,其實施步驟如下:1)建立業務關鍵數據文件列表;2)實時檢測文件系統的每一個文件寫入操作;3)將文件寫入操作的目標文件與業務關鍵數據文件列表進行比較,如果匹配則首先執行文件寫入操作,然后在文件寫入操作完畢后為文件寫入操作的目標文件建立備份文件。作為本專利技術上述技術方案的進一步改進:所述業務關鍵數據文件列表包含每一個業務關鍵數據文件的哈希值;所述步驟3)中將目標文件與業務關鍵數據文件列表進行比較的詳細步驟如下:3.1)獲取文件寫入操作的目標文件;3.2)獲取目標文件的哈希值;3.3)將目標文件的哈希值與所述業務關鍵數據文件列表中的每一個業務關鍵數據文件的哈希值進行比較,如果業務關鍵數據文件列表中存在相同的哈希值則判定比較結果為匹配,否則判定比較結果為不匹配。所述哈希值具體是指業務關鍵數據文件的md5文件校驗碼。所述步驟3)中執行文件寫入操作的詳細操作步驟如下:3.4)判斷文件寫入操作的目標文件大小,如果目標文件大小小于預設值,則跳轉執行步驟3.5),否則跳轉執行步驟3.6);3.5)執行文件寫入操作,并將目標文件讀取進入內存中;3.6)執行文件寫入操作。所述步驟3)中為文件寫入操作的目標文件建立備份文件的詳細步驟如下:檢測內存中是否存在目標文件,如果內存中存在目標文件則將內存中的目標文件寫入磁盤中建立備份文件,如果內存中不存在目標文件目標文件則直接通過DMA操作建立備份文件。本專利技術具有下述優點本專利技術通過實時檢測文件系統的每一個文件寫入操作,將文件寫入操作的目標文件與業務關鍵數據文件列表進行比較,如果匹配則首先執行文件寫入操作,然后在文件寫入操作完畢后為文件寫入操作的目標文件建立備份文件,能夠為業務關鍵數據根據文件寫入操作建立實時副本,具有可靠性高、資源消耗低、實用性好、操作簡單方便的優點。附圖說明為了更清楚地說明本專利技術實施例或現有技術中的技術方案,下面將對實施例或現有技術描述中所需要使用的附圖作簡單地介紹,顯而易見地,下面描述中的附圖僅僅是本專利技術的一些實施例,對于本領域普通技術人員來講,在不付出創造性勞動的前提下,還可以根據這些附圖獲得其他的附圖。圖1為本專利技術實施例的基本流程示意圖。具體實施方式下面結合附圖對本專利技術的優選實施例進行詳細闡述,以使本專利技術的優點和特征能更易于被本領域技術人員理解,從而對本專利技術的保護范圍做出更為清楚明確的界定。如圖1所示,本專利技術實施例業務關鍵數據的實時備份方法的實施步驟如下:1)建立業務關鍵數據文件列表;2)實時檢測文件系統的每一個文件寫入操作;3)將文件寫入操作的目標文件與業務關鍵數據文件列表進行比較,如果匹配則首先執行文件寫入操作,然后在文件寫入操作完畢后為文件寫入操作的目標文件建立備份文件。本實施例中,業務關鍵數據文件列表包含每一個業務關鍵數據文件的哈希值;步驟3)中將目標文件與業務關鍵數據文件列表進行比較的詳細步驟如下:3.1)獲取文件寫入操作的目標文件;3.2)獲取目標文件的哈希值;3.3)將目標文件的哈希值與業務關鍵數據文件列表中的每一個業務關鍵數據文件的哈希值進行比較,如果業務關鍵數據文件列表中存在相同的哈希值則判定比較結果為匹配,否則判定比較結果為不匹配。本實施例中,采用哈希值的比較方式相對直接采用文件路徑比較的方式而言,由于哈希值為定長而且長度較短,因此比較過程的速度更快,比較效率更好,能夠更加節省系統資源。本實施例中,哈希值具體是指業務關鍵數據文件的md5文件校驗碼,md5文件校驗碼的生成效率高。本實施例中,步驟3)中執行文件寫入操作的詳細操作步驟如下:3.4)判斷文件寫入操作的目標文件大小,如果目標文件大小小于預設值,則跳轉執行步驟3.5),否則跳轉執行步驟3.6);3.5)執行文件寫入操作,并將目標文件讀取進入內存中;3.6)執行文件寫入操作。本實施例中,步驟3)中為文件寫入操作的目標文件建立備份文件的詳細步驟如下:檢測內存中是否存在目標文件,如果內存中存在目標文件則將內存中的目標文件寫入磁盤中建立備份文件,如果內存中不存在目標文件目標文件則直接通過DMA操作建立備份文件。以上所述僅為本專利技術的優選實施方式,本專利技術的保護范圍并不僅限于上述實施方式,凡是屬于本專利技術原理的技術方案均屬于本專利技術的保護范圍。對于本領域的技術人員而言,在不脫離本專利技術的原理的前提下進行的若干改進和潤飾,這些改進和潤飾也應視為本專利技術的保護范圍。本文檔來自技高網...

    【技術保護點】
    一種業務關鍵數據的實時備份方法,其特征在于其實施步驟如下:1)建立業務關鍵數據文件列表;2)實時檢測文件系統的每一個文件寫入操作;3)將文件寫入操作的目標文件與業務關鍵數據文件列表進行比較,如果匹配則首先執行文件寫入操作,然后在文件寫入操作完畢后為文件寫入操作的目標文件建立備份文件。

    【技術特征摘要】
    1.一種業務關鍵數據的實時備份方法,其特征在于其實施步驟如下:
    1)建立業務關鍵數據文件列表;
    2)實時檢測文件系統的每一個文件寫入操作;
    3)將文件寫入操作的目標文件與業務關鍵數據文件列表進行比較,如果匹配則首先執行文件寫入操作,然后在文件寫入操作完畢后為文件寫入操作的目標文件建立備份文件。
    2.根據權利要求1所述的業務關鍵數據的實時備份方法,其特征在于,所述業務關鍵數據文件列表包含每一個業務關鍵數據文件的哈希值;所述步驟3)中將目標文件與業務關鍵數據文件列表進行比較的詳細步驟如下:
    3.1)獲取文件寫入操作的目標文件;
    3.2)獲取目標文件的哈希值;
    3.3)將目標文件的哈希值與所述業務關鍵數據文件列表中的每一個業務關鍵數據文件的哈希值進行比較,如果業務關鍵數據文件列表中存在相同的哈希值則判定比較結果為匹配,否則判定比較結果為...

    【專利技術屬性】
    技術研發人員:顧勝溢
    申請(專利權)人:上海歐朋軟件有限公司
    類型:發明
    國別省市:上海;31

    網友詢問留言 已有0條評論
    • 還沒有人留言評論。發表了對其他瀏覽者有用的留言會獲得科技券。

    1
    主站蜘蛛池模板: 亚洲精品色午夜无码专区日韩| 色视频综合无码一区二区三区| 无码专区天天躁天天躁在线| 精品久久亚洲中文无码| 亚洲av无码成人影院一区 | 中文字幕日产无码| AV无码精品一区二区三区| 日韩A无码AV一区二区三区| 亚洲AV无码久久| 亚洲日韩精品无码专区网站| 欧洲Av无码放荡人妇网站| 久久久久久国产精品无码下载| 亚洲性无码一区二区三区| 亚洲国产精品无码久久一线| 午夜无码一区二区三区在线观看 | 久久AV无码精品人妻糸列| 特级无码毛片免费视频| 精品久久久久久中文字幕无码| 午夜亚洲AV日韩AV无码大全| 亚洲午夜AV无码专区在线播放| 亚洲综合无码一区二区痴汉| 日韩欧精品无码视频无删节| 一本色道无码道在线观看| 一本色道无码道在线| 国产午夜av无码无片久久96| 精品日韩亚洲AV无码一区二区三区| 在线播放无码后入内射少妇| 亚洲精品无码av天堂| 无码人妻一区二区三区在线水卜樱| 中字无码av电影在线观看网站| 亚洲av永久无码精品三区在线4| 野花在线无码视频在线播放| 久久久久亚洲?V成人无码| 中文字幕无码一区二区三区本日| 精品久久久久久无码人妻| 亚洲国产成人精品无码区二本| 亚洲AV无码精品国产成人| 无码人妻精品一区二区三区9厂| 亚洲中文字幕无码爆乳app| 国产精品无码亚洲精品2021| 国产精品无码制服丝袜|